Oilcan vs Oilman - What's the difference?

oilcan | oilman |

As nouns the difference between oilcan and oilman

is that oilcan is a container with a long spout, for containing oil and delivering it in drops or small quantities for lubricating machinery while oilman is somebody involved in the production, refinement or delivery of oil; such as an oil field worker or executive, or the owner of an oil well.
